The serious damage of coastal dikes occurred in the tsunami caused by the 2011 off the Pacific coast of Tohoku earthquake. It is important to reinforce the coastal dikes with concrete blocks and to give the function of tenacious structures. In case of coastal dikes, the stability and damage of coastal dikes are affected by the strength of foundation in spillway and the fluid forces acting on concrete blocks armoring on slope just near the crest of dikes in the side of land for the over flow in tsunami. The relationship between the upstream depth and pressure distributions under the concrete blocks on the mound of slope, and the fluid forces and overturning moment acting on a concrete block adjacent to the crest of dike in the side of land. It becomes clear that the concrete block leaves from the crest of dikes in the side of land in the case of overturning moment exceeding the gravity moment of the concrete block in water.
